About This Quiz

Welcome to the ultimate Monopoly challenge! Are you ready to test your skills against the Monopoly Banker on National Play Monopoly Day? This iconic board game is a household favorite that puts your financial prowess and strategic acumen to the test. With this quiz, we invite you to dive into the world of Monopoly, exploring its history, rules, and the key tactics needed to emerge victorious.

On National Play Monopoly Day, immerse yourself in the realm of property acquisition, rent collection, and sharp business decisions. This quiz is designed to captivate both novices and seasoned Monopoly veterans, delving into the nuances of the game's creation, the concept behind its economic theories, and the gameplay mechanics that define this classic pastime.

Challenge yourself with a series of questions covering the game's founding principles, strategies to bankrupt opponents, and the roles of the Banker and the various cards, as you strive to prove your dominance in the world of Monopoly.
